Output 59d69786d3c894052d701eb8da295624776141f36efcd7e97e12fb20f18eb9f3:0

value
1259006
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8f7680200d94539f9b7ae1cdd7f007ad5d05afbe OP_EQUALVERIFY OP_CHECKSIG
address
1E5ZazRci68nxJFP2WYgTvGtc8QrrBwrQR
transaction
59d69786d3c894052d701eb8da295624776141f36efcd7e97e12fb20f18eb9f3
spent
true